Motor cells are found in

1)

Monocot leaf

2)

Upper epidermis of monocot leaf

3)

Brain

4)

Spinal cord

1 Answer - 5876 Votes

3537

Answer Key : (2) -

Motor cells or bulliform cells are found in epidermis of monocot leaf, e.g., grasses. Epidermal cells situated in ling furrows are larger with thin flexible walls. These cells help in the rolling of leaves in dry weather.
